With businesses especially reaping financial and technical rewards from VoIP technology, carriers are increasingly in demand. Here’s a quick look at their role in the VoIP world.


While there are home canada telegram users, the predominant market is among businesses. To utilise VoIP, a few basics are needed after the physical set-up. For example, Session Initiation Protocol (SIP). This is flexible and allows for multimedia via IP/TCP networks and means calls can be set up with various IP protocols, from Transmission Control Protocol (TCP to Stream Control Transmission Protocol (SCTP).

There are also DID (Direct Inward Dialing) numbers required, the numbers assigned to the gateway connecting the PTSN to the VoIP network. Voice termination parameters define the end point at which the call is received, anywhere worldwide. VoIP data packets ultimately have to be reassembled from their digital format into the appropriate form, whether video or voice, for the recipient.

The role of VoIP carriers
VoIP carriers will vary in terms of the scope of their solutions and how they offer them, from Tier 1 providers to resellers. Many VoIP providers will supply DID numbers and integrate cloud-based PBX with the package, connecting calls set for a particular destination to the incoming line. One of the major advantages of VoIP is the separation of the number from the physical location, allowing for portability and location independence.
